Guarda Wallets features and specs

  • Multi-Currency Support
    Guarda Wallets support a wide range of cryptocurrencies, allowing users to store, manage, and exchange different digital assets all in one place.
  • Non-Custodial
    Users have full control over their private keys, ensuring that only they have access to their funds, which enhances security and privacy.
  • Platform Accessibility
    Available on multiple platforms such as web, desktop, mobile, and browser extensions, providing easy access and convenience for different user preferences.
  • Integrated Exchange Feature
    It offers an integrated exchange service, allowing for quick and easy swaps between cryptocurrencies without leaving the wallet interface.
  • Security Features
    Guarda provides strong security features including encryption and backup options to enhance the safety of users' funds.

assertpy features and specs

  • Fluent API
    Assertpy offers a fluent API that makes assertions more readable and expressive, enabling developers to write assertions in a natural language style that is easy to understand.
  • Chainable Assertions
    It allows for chainable assertions, enabling multiple checks to be performed in a single line of code, thereby reducing verbosity and enhancing clarity.
  • Comprehensive Assertion Methods
    The library provides a wide range of built-in assertion methods, catering to various types of data validations, such as checking for size, type, value, and more.
  • Extensibility
    Assertpy supports extending its functionality by defining custom assertions, allowing developers to tailor it to their specific needs.
  • Pythonic
    Designed with Pythonic principles in mind, Assertpy fits seamlessly into Python projects, enabling idiomatic and consistent code style.

The 7 Best Bitcoin Wallets That You Should Use For Storing BTC
Guarda is non HD wallet which provides you with a 12-word backup seed key which you should write down somewhere and keep safe. In case you damage or lose your device, this backup seed key will enable you to recover your bitcoins.
Source: coinsutra.com
